Command StepMotorAtPower Method (OutputPort, Int32, UInt32, UInt32, UInt32, Boolean)LEGO Mindstorms EV3 API Documentation

Step the motor connected to the specified port or ports at the specified power for the specified number of steps.

Namespace: Lego.Ev3.Core
Assembly: Lego.Ev3.Desktop (in Lego.Ev3.Desktop.dll) Version: 1.0.0.0 (1.0.0.0)
Syntax

public void StepMotorAtPower(
	OutputPort ports,
	int power,
	uint rampUpSteps,
	uint constantSteps,
	uint rampDownSteps,
	bool brake
)

Parameters

ports
Type: Lego.Ev3.Core OutputPort
A specific port or Ports.All.
power
Type: OnlineSystem Int32
The power at which to turn the motor (-100% to 100%).
rampUpSteps
Type: OnlineSystem UInt32
